Title: Creating a Now/Next/Later Operability Improvements Roadmap
Time: 30 mins - 1 hour
Introduction: Improving operability can mean changes to many of the foundations of your system and ways of working. This can be big and scary for everyone involved. Its important to create a vision for operability that picks off the most important things to improve early on but allows you to cast your minds forward. I use the runbook template and put each area into the following:
- Now - things we can work on now to make a difference immediately
- Next - once we have worked on the Now’s, we will enable the Next’s
- Later - things we want a home for but will tackle them later if we still need to
Purpose: Create a visual roadmap for operability improvements without overwhelming the team with too much.
Activity:
- If you completed the Matching Testing Activities to Operability Improvements exercise, use this list as an input. Otherwise get a copy of the run book template and discuss with your team which areas you want to focus on.
- For each run book category (or related task if there are specifics), place in either:
- Now
- Next
- Later
- Write up your findings and add them to the README.md file in your application repo (or wherever your team stores its documentation. Alternatively create these as items for your backlog, if you have buy in from the team.
